笔者是来自某985高校信息科学与技术大类的一名大一学生。从初中第一次接触linux开始,我就对其基本操作以及简单应用产生了兴趣,并且一直想搭建一个个人博客,但是由于学业压力繁重一直未能着手实践。这次大一暑假,学业之余略有空闲,于是对个人博客的原理以及搭建方法进行了简单了解并开始尝试。起初我误以为家中校园网分配的IP地址是公网IP,并使用自己的老旧手提电脑作为网站的服务器载体,最终失败。后来了解到要解决这个问题,一种是通过花生壳等工具进行内网穿透,一种则是通过租用服务器租赁商的服务器以获得公网IP。因为素来对阿里云的服务器租赁服务有所耳闻,于是便在网络上搜索到了阿里云的ECS服务,随之了解到了阿里云为高校学生提供的惠利。
阿里云的ECS服务使用起来还是相当便利的。在任务界面申领了两周的ECS使用资格后,只需经过简单的选择就可以完成对于ECS服务器的初始化。初始化完成后,便可以通过workbench进行在线连接。连接的延迟相当低,操作也很流畅,对于存储盘上的文件还可以调出可视化界面呈现,对于我这种首次上手linux命令行操作的新手可以说是相当友好。我的网站采用LNMP的构建模式,Linux环境已经在初始化ECS实例时配置好,因此我只需要安装nginx、MySQL和WordPress就可以开始进行搭建工作了。我根据相关教程全程在workbench上操作,中途除了vim操作生疏导致遇到了一点点阻碍以外,剩下的流程都顺风顺水,经过不到1小时就完成了所有前置准备工作。此后的流程便不再需要在workbench上操作,可以直接通过访问ECS实例的公网ip/wp-admin即可进行相关配置。现在,我的网站已经初具雏形。
我在本次使用ECS服务进行网站搭建实践的过程中受益匪浅。我不仅对域名、DNS等网络基本知识有了更深入的了解,也对服务器租赁等流程有了初步的体验。我还通过对wordpress的网页模板进行研究并对其进行一定程度的DIY,浅尝了网站前端的构建,加深了对HTML等的理解。虽然我并不确定自己将来的方向,但是这次实践提振了我对于网络相关知识的兴趣,使我更加期待未来的专业课学习。我将不忘初心,砥砺奋进,锻炼自身本领,创造人生价值。
以下是网站示意。